Low latency connections are best for competitive gamers, IT professionals, or doctors performing remote procedures. It’s a measurement of delay in a network. Latency isn’t the same thing as bandwidth. For instance, a high-speed but low bandwidth Internet connection can slow down if multiple users are downloading 4K movies simultaneously. While bandwidth is the maximum theoretical volume of data that can transfer in an Internet connection, speed is how fast data transfers. No, bandwidth is not the same thing as Internet speed. But a larger household with people streaming films, games, and other content simultaneously will benefit from greater bandwidth. Similarly, an Internet connection with less bandwidth may suffice if it only serves one user. Either tunnel will do for a trip if traffic volume is low, but the tunnel with the lower bandwidth is more likely to slow down from congestion during peak hours. While one tunnel has a two-lane road, the other with the greater bandwidth has an eight-lane road. In family life, a parent might speak of their “bandwidth” to tolerate their kids' shenanigans.īack to Internet bandwidth, a good analogy would be to picture two car tunnels with the same speed limits. In work settings, you might talk about your bandwidth or your team’s bandwidth to handle a certain amount of work. The term “bandwidth” is also often used in other colloquial ways. It’s typically measured in megabits per second (Mbps) and isn't the same as Internet speed. In Internet terms, bandwidth refers to the amount of data that can transfer over a connection.
